Go Fish Digital and Converge Partner to Unlock Real-Time Insight from Younger Audiences

Go Fish Digital recently partnered with Converge to run their first live research sessions—engaging younger audiences to better understand what drives interest in service and mentorship roles, what creates friction, and where opportunities can connect more clearly.

The project was designed to move quickly from question → participants → insight—without the typical delays of traditional research.

Project Snapshot

  • 2 live sessions (60 minutes each)

  • 43 participants (ages 16–25)

  • 93% show rate

  • 9.33 / 10 avg participant rating

All participants were recruited directly through Converge’s integrated User Interviews panel, enabling a seamless recruit-to-session workflow in just days.

Impact Beyond the Session

The work supports a broader initiative: a network of 1,100+ Student Success Coaches across 14 community-based organizations in California, serving as near-peer mentors in public schools.

Understanding how younger audiences perceive mentorship—and what motivates participation—is critical to strengthening that ecosystem.
